About Chuanlong Han

Chuanlong Han is a scholar working on Renewable Energy, Sustainability and the Environment, Surfaces, Coatings and Films and Electronic, Optical and Magnetic Materials, having authored 20 papers that have together received 1.2k indexed citations. Recurring topics across this work include Solar-Powered Water Purification Methods (5 papers), Supercapacitor Materials and Fabrication (5 papers) and Advanced Sensor and Energy Harvesting Materials (5 papers). The work is most often cited by research in Electronic, Optical and Magnetic Materials (514 citations), Renewable Energy, Sustainability and the Environment (449 citations) and Water Science and Technology (151 citations). Chuanlong Han has collaborated with scholars based in China, United States and Russia. Frequent co-authors include Yong Wang, Jiang Deng, Yutong Gong, Mingming Li, Jing Wang, Fan Xu, Haiyan Wang, Tianyi Xiong, Haoran Li and Zhuangzhi Sun. Their work appears in journals such as Journal of the American Chemical Society, Nature Communications and Chemistry of Materials.
